MK Meir Cohen (Yesh Atid) quoted from the 'Unetaneh Tokef' prayer during a Knesset debate on the proposed Basic Law: Torah Study. 'The High Holy Days of the Knesset of Israel. Who will live and who will die,' Cohen said, citing the Yom Kippur liturgy. The debate has been contentious; earlier in the session, a PTSD-stricken reservist disrupted proceedings, according to i24NEWS. The Basic Law: Torah Study, which would enshrine Torah study as a fundamental right, has drawn sharp opposition from secular and ultra-Orthodox factions alike.
